Advantages of Ethernet over Copper
Ethernet over Copper (EoC) is a kind of Ethernet in the very first mile line that uses twisted copper telephone wire pairs that are usually already in place in numerous service areas. For that reason, it is typically quicker to provide EoC than to build out brand-new fiber circuits in older service locations.
Ethernet over Copper is a mature and reliable technology offering the exact same features as conventional T1 lines: dedicated, symmetrical, and also full duplex. Its major advantage is that Ethernet over Copper is provided over copper pairs of DS0 so EoC does not call for pricey fiber build outs. An additional wonderful advantage over conventional T1 lines is that an Ethernet circuit is much easier to update. With the traditional bonded T1, an upgrade in circuit speeds could take months because the local telephone company has to install added circuits. With an Ethernet circuit, the port speed could frequently be raised as just a configuration change at the central office. Ethernet over Copper runs over a number of pairs of copper so if one pair goes down, the bandwidth available does go down yet you do not loose the whole circuit as you would certainly with a T1 line. Ethernet over Copper pricing is much lower than that of bonded T1 circuits of the very same speed. EoC circuits have a Service Level Agreement (SLA) much like T1 lines typically with the exact identical guarantees.
